    For adding acids and bases to water (and not the other way around) I always remember "do as you oughta, add acid to watta."
    The reason you add them in that order is that dispersing acid or base in its first little bit of water generates a lot of heat, and adding extra water to acid/base solution that already has some doesn't generate much more. So if you had a drop of water on top of a big pile of lye, you'd get all the heat of dissolving a big pile of lye, and only a single drop of water to absorb it. That can violently boil the water, flinging lye at you with steam pressure.

      Almond and coconut oils have different fat contents. In order to switch out oils in a soap/shampoo recipe, you’ll need to run it through a soap calculator. That will tell you exactly how much lye you need to break down each oil. It will be different for almond oil than it will for coconut oil. Also, it’s very difficult to get any lather without using coconut oil.

      The lye is what turns the oils into soap, and it gets completely used up in the process of saponification. Castile soap is just another kind of soap that was made with lye too. If you tried to replace the lye with castile soap, you'd just have a liquid oily soap combination.
